Removing and installing/replacing top trim on
rear apron

Necessary preliminary tasks:

Remove luggage compartment floor trim (luggage

compartment mat)

Release expansion rivets (1).

Lever out protective caps (2) and release screws underneath.

Lever out trim (3) inwards/upwards.

Installation:

If necessary, replace damaged protective caps (2).

Make sure trim (3) is correctly seated on rear lid mucket.
